Course Details

• Introduction to Ship Management
• Maritime Law and Regulations
• Ship Operations and Safety
• Ship Maintenance and Engineering
• Crew Resource Management
• Ship Finance and Economics
• Maritime Environmental Management
• Ship Chartering and Agency
• Ship Management Information Systems

Fleet managers, navigational officers, marine engineers, ship's captains, and cargo operations managers are the key positions in this industry. In the UK, fleet managers account for approximately 20% of the ship management job market. They are responsible for managing and maintaining a fleet of ships, ensuring their safe and efficient operation. Navigational officers, who typically handle ship navigation and communication, make up 25% of the market. Marine engineers, who design, build, and maintain marine vessels, comprise 30% of the ship management roles. Ship's captains, responsible for the overall operation of the vessel, represent 15% of the market. Cargo operations managers, who oversee the loading and unloading of goods, account for the remaining 10%.
